Adaptive Filters

Order printed collection

Collection type: Course

Course by: Douglas L. Jones. E-mail the author

Start »

Collection Properties

Summary: Covers different types of adaptive filters and their implementations. In depth analysis is done of the Wiener Filter algorithm and the LMS algorithm.

Instructor: Douglas Jones

Institution: University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ign
